Title:
STIMULATORJI RASTI V EKOLOŠKI PRIDELAVI KOLERABICE

Abstract:
V letih 2006 in 2007 je bil na kolerabici v rastlinjaku in na poskusnem polju Fakultete za kmetijstvo Univerze v Mariboru preizkušen vpliv različnih stimulatorjev rasti (Agrovit, Coralit, HB 101, Vita). Pri vzgoji sadik so bili uporabljeni posamezni stimulatorji rasti in njihove kombinacije. S stimulatorjem rasti HB 101 je bilo pred setvijo tretirano seme, Agrovit je bil primešan substratu, Coralit je bil na rastline nanesen foliarno. Preizkušeni stimulatorji rasti so statistično značilno vplivali na nekatere morfološke lastnosti sadik (višino sadik, maso sadik, število listov in maso korenin) in na nekatere morfološke lastnosti rastlin kolerabice (položaj listov, višina rastline, širina rastline, masa rastline, dolžina kocena, število listov, premer in masa odebeljenega stebla) ter na skupni pridelek kolerabice. Vplivali so tudi na vsebnost vitamina C in nitratov v rastlinskem soku. Stimulator rasti Vita, ki je bil preizkušen na rastlinah na polju in je bil med rastno dobo na rastline apliciran foliarno, ni imel statistično značilnega vpliva na pridelek in morfološke lastnosti kolerabice. V prvem in drugem terminu vrednotenja sadik sta imela največji vpliv na rast in razvoj sadik stimulatorja rasti HB 101 in Agrovit ter njuna kombinacija. Največji vpliv na morfološke lastnosti rastlin na polju je imel stimulator rasti HB 101, v tem obravnavanju je bil prav tako dosežen najvišji tržni pridelek (11,3 t/ha) in najvišji skupni pridelek (14,4 t/ha).

Title:
GROWTH STIMULATORS IN ORGANIC PRODUCTION OF KOHLRABI
Abstract:
At the Faculty of Agriculture of Maribor University, in the years 2006 and 2007 we carried out greenhouse and field trials with the aim to investigate the effects of growth stimulators (Agrovit, Coralit, HB 101, Vita) on the organic production of kohlrabi. For the growth of seedlings we used individual growth stimulators and their combinations. Before sowing, seeds were soaked by HB 101, Agrovit was added to the potting mix, whereas Coralit was sprayed to foliage. The tested growth stimulators had a statistically significant effect on some morphological traits of seedlings (height, weight, number of leaves and root weight) and on some morphological traits of kohlrabi plants (location of leaves, plant height, width and weight, length of stalk, number of leaves, diameter and weight of enlarged stem) and on kohlrabi total yield, as well as effects on vitamin C content and the content of nitrates in the plant sap. Vita growth stimulator used in field trials and sprayed to foliage did not statistically significantly affect the kohlrabi yield and morphological traits. In the first and second evaluation of seedlings, HB 101, Agrovit and their combinations had the most significant effect on the growth and development of seedlings. HB 101 affected morphological traits of plants most significantly and also resulted in the highest market yield (11,3 t/ha) and the highest total yield (14,4 t/ha).
